Bug Description

I was wondering why the application panels (particularly the Top panel) keeps corrupting in 10.04? The top panel ranges from showing no network icon to showing 2, the missing mail icon (replaced by second battery icon) plus the missing shutdown icon which instead is replaced by my duplicated user-name! I have undertaken numerous resets in order return them to default but it is now getting tiresome to say the least! I keep and have an updated system but alas this issue is still occurring - I am aware via the forums that other users are experiencing such issues - are the Ubuntu support/development teams not aware of this? When can this officially be fixed?
